Is Bryan suitable for beginners? 

Very much so. He is simply knitted flat on a pair of 4mm knitting needles, making him an excellent project for a beginner who knows the basics of knitting: no need to knit in the round. 

Basic skills that you need to know:

Stocking stitch, increasing by knitting into the front and back of a stitch (inc 1) and decreasing by knitting 2 stitches together (k2tog). There’s colour-changing on some rows, so you will need to use Intarsia technique to change yarns mid-row. Head on over to my how to knit tutorials if you need any advice!

What's included in your knit kit?

A full colour 5-page printed knitting pattern

  • 5 different colours of high quality, soft DK acrylic yarn
  • Polyester toy stuffing
  • Black beads
  • Black cotton thread
  • Pipe cleaner
  • Yellow felt
  • A booby button badge

All kit and parcel packaging is plastic-free, and recyclable.

The gift box measures 28cm x 19cm x 8cm.

Bryan the Booby is 22cm tall.
